> ActiveMQ broker shuts down shortly after losing lease
> -----------------------------------------------------
>
> Key: AMQ-6307
> UR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/AMQ-6307
> Project: ActiveMQ
> Issue Type: Bug
> Affects Versions: 5.12.1
> Reporter: Brett Geer
>
> When using LeaseDatabaseLocker, the master releases it's lease as configured
> but when it tries to get it back and fails, it promptly shuts down. See below
> 2016-05-30 12:10:39,422 | INFO | xx Lease held by xx till Mon May 30
> 12:10:48 SAST 2016 | org.apache.activemq.store.jdbc.LeaseDatabaseLocker |
> ActiveMQ JDBC PA Scheduled Task
> 2016-05-30 12:10:39,423 | ERROR | localhost, no longer able to keep the
> exclusive lock so giving up being a master |
> org.apache.activemq.broker.LockableServiceSupport | ActiveMQ JDBC PA
> Scheduled Task
> 2016-05-30 12:10:39,427 | INFO | Apache ActiveMQ 5.12.1 (localhost,
> ID:xx160818-1464599650782-1:1) is shutting down |
> org.apache.activemq.broker.BrokerService | ActiveMQ JDBC PA Scheduled Task
